Thank you - I appreciate someone quoting me on the "high flake factor".

I've organized several local meets, and it's always this way. Even when there's free food, etc. Saying it comes with the territory may seem like a trite response, but it's also true, unfortunately.

I don't think that there's really any way to guarantee that people are going to show. I didn't stay for lunch, so I don't know how nice the lunch was, but to a company that large, the costs associated with this event are a drop in the bucket. And they should understand about no shows; there must have been an event coordinator there who does these things, and is familiar with participant projections.

On the other hand, maybe if the event were changed so that it wasn't 5 hours of sitting around and talking, and either shorter or with a driving portion, more people might have showed up. And of course, you can't change the weather. Sh*t happens.
